A man that was allegedly brutalised and shot on the leg by some soldiers in Benin, the Edo State capital, has raised an alarm over what he called the inhuman treatment meted out to him.
But the Nigerian Army has insisted that the man, Mr. Daniel Owie, is an armed robber, who attempted to snatch the soldiers’ vehicle.
The soldiers, who were reportedly led by an Army Captain, actually brutalized Owie before shooting him on the leg.
In a petition to the Inspector-General of Police, Mr. Solomon Arase, the victim appealed to him to investigate the alleged murder attempt on his life and the breach of his fundamental human rights by a group of soldiers led by a yet to be identified captain in Benin, Daily Sun reports.
Mr. Owie is currently receiving treatment at the University of Benin Teaching Hospital (UBTH) where he was chained to the bed allegedly on the orders of the Army Captain. The captain also detailed two soldiers to watch over him.
Owie said on October 3, about 8.pm, he met a vehicle that blocked Ihama Road and he went to the car to see if he could assist the owners to push the vehicle off the road.
He said that the occupants of the vehicle ordered him to go back to his car, adding that the way and manner they talked to him led to an exchange of words.
He was subsequently given the beating of his life by the soldiers, he stated.
“Our client told us further that he was surprised that one of them introduced himself as a captain in the Nigerian Army and he further identified himself by brandishing his service pistol.
“After the beating, the said the captain called his military boys, who came in a Hilux Pick-up van and, without questions and after he identified him to them, started to beat him again with fists and gun butt.
“He further said he was shot on his leg on the instruction of the said captain. He also said that there were bruises all over his body, inflicted by the military men called by the captain.”
Owie alleged in the petition that after shooting him, they took him to the hospital in their military base along the Airport Road, Benin, where medical doctors on duty told them that they would not admit him on the ground that the military men were not consistent in their statement as per how he was shot.
He said he was later taken to the University of Benin Teaching Hospital where he was admitted. He also alleged that his KIA SUV, two handsets, wristwatch and eyeglasses were taken away from him by the said captain and his boys.
“As if (as an) afterthought, at about 10am on Sunday, October 4, 2015, the said captain led other military officers to the University of Benin Teaching Hospital to handcuff him to the bed and detailed two military men to watch over him. They alleged that he was shot because he wanted to snatch their car from them,” the petition said.
But in a swift reaction, spokesman of the 4 Brigade of the Nigerian Army, Benin, Capt. Joseph Unuakhalu, said Owie was a member of a robbery gang, who robbed an army officer along Ihama Road on the fateful day and was arrested by personnel of the Nigerian Air Force.
The Army statement reads:
“At about 10:30pm on 3 October 2015, Troops of 4 Brigade Garrison responding to a distress call, rescued an army officer, who was attacked by suspected armed robbers at Ihama Junction, along Airport Road, Benin city. “During the attack, the officers index finger was cut off by the suspected robbers.
“Earlier, the gang robbed two policemen from Lagos Command, who came for their colleague’s wedding. Prior to the troops’ arrival, personnel of the Nigerian Air Force close to the scene responded and arrested one of the suspected robbers, Mr. Daniel Owie, while others ran away abandoning a Kia Sportage Jeep with Reg No EDO BEN 190 BR.
“He was handed over to oour troops on arrival. However, the suspect attempted to escape and was shot on his left leg. Suspect is currently receiving treatment at UBTH while investigations are ongoing.”
At the time of this report, Owie was still receiving treatment at the hospital. When contacted, medical director of the hospital, Prof. Michael Ibadin, said he was not aware of the development.
Timothy Ojomandu, an alleged of a three-man gang that hides under gridlock to attack and rob motorists around Mile 2 area in the state was apprehended over the weekend .
According to Vanguard, the suspect was caught in the act at about 7:30 pm by the team of policemen who responded to a distress call made by the driver of Mitsubishi Canter with number plate, FKJ 676 XF, after the suspect and his gang members had successfully stolen one carton of cell battery from the truck which was fully loaded with hundreds of the cartons.
The truck driver, Mr. Ajiboye Mogaji, who accompanied the suspect to the RRS Headquarters at Alausa, told the Police that he sighted the suspect from the side mirror of his vehicle when he sneaked-in through the back of the truck.
He said:
‘’When I saw him sneaking-in to my truck, I pretended as if I didn’t see him. While inside the truck, he passed one carton to his partner who was moving beside the vehicle. As soon as I saw him passing one carton to his partner on the ground, I rushed down on motion.
However, when his partner saw me alighting from the vehicle, he absconded with that one carton, and I held the suspect by his trousers when he wanted to jump down from the truck. Then, I shouted for help and the Policemen from RRS who were patrolling the area responded swiftly to the distress call.”
The suspect, who confessed to the crime, said he was just being recruited into the group about two months ago.
“Our robbery gang was in the habit of stealing handsets and other valuables from pedestrians and motorists during the peak period of traffic congestion along the area. I was a bus conductor before Victor Chibonwu, our gang leader, introduced me to the act of theft. On the fateful day, I, Victor and Richard went to Mile 2, looking for our would-be victims.
On getting to the spot, we saw one truck fully loaded with cell batteries heading towards Ijora, and it was held up in the traffic.
I now got the opportunity to enter inside the truck from behind. I succeeded in removing one carton of the battery and passed it to my partner walking beside me, and in the process to pass another one, the driver showed up and held me tight by my trousers before he handed me over to the Police but my other colleagues were able to run away with one carton of the battery,” he confessed
The suspect, who hails from Isseke Local Government Area in Anambra State, simply disclosed their receiver as Mr. Gawo, who owns shops at Tin-Can Island, Apapa, in the state.
“We do sell all our stolen goods to him. He operates many shops at Tin-Can Island. Victor was the one who usually takes the stolen goods to him after each operation,” the suspect added.
The suspect has been transferred to Special Anti-Robbery Squad, SARS, for further investigation.

The above pictured woman has been labelled the ‘Ugliest in The world’ and she has revealed the fantastic way she tackles online bullying.
Lizzie Velasquez, now 26, was born with a rare disease that makes her blind in one eye and prevents her from gaining weight.
Her life changed for ever after she stumbled across a YouTube video labelled ‘the world’s ugliest woman.’.
Lizzie, who was just 17 at the time, was horrified to find that the girl in the clip was her.
The vicious footage was watched four million times online, with many leaving disgusting comments about Lizzie, including suggestions that she should have been killed at birth.
But inspirational Lizzie said she managed to turn the horrific comments into something positive.
She told Fox News:
“There were thousands and thousands of awful comments, all along the lines of: the world would be a better place if I weren’t in it.
“Each comment I read I felt like someone was physically putting their fist through the screen and punching me.
“I always knew I wanted to show those people that they weren’t going to define me.
“I didn’t want the definition of me that they were creating to become my truth.”
Lizzie has now has released a documentary to inspire others, ‘A Brave Heart: The Lizzie Velasquez story’.
She also travels the world helping troubled youngsters. Lizzie said she makes others who have been bullied for the way they look feel able to seek help, or stand up to the bullies.

The World Health Organisation, WHO has newly revealed that one out of every six Africans suffer from mental disorder.
The statistics was announced on Saturday by the World Health Organisation Regional Director for Africa, Dr. Matshidiso Moeti, during a message she delivered on this year’s World Mental Health Day.
In a statement issued by WHO, Moeti is quoted:
“On 10 October 2015, we join the rest of the world in commemorating World Mental Health Day under the theme, ‘Dignity in mental health’.
“The theme draws attention to the crucial need to ensure that dignity is preserved in all aspects of mental health, ranging from care for patients to the attitudes of the general public.
“In the African Region, it is estimated that one out of every six people suffers from some form of mental disorder. Unfortunately, in the course of treatment, some patients are subjected to undignified treatment, such as being chained to trees or beds, locked in a cage, left without food for many hours, deprived from family support and inadequate personal hygiene.”
According to Moeti, mental health patients deserve respect and compassion as they cope with their disease, as it is expected of those who suffer from any other disease.
Oh well, it looks like rapper, 50 Cent has lost his star power as he has been forced to drop the price of his huge Connecticut mansion yet again in his latest attempt to sell the property.
The 50,000-square-foot home in Farmington, with 21 bedrooms and 25 bathrooms, has been listed for sale priced $8.5million. He had originally listed the property for sale in 2007 for $18.5million – but the price has been dropped several times in subsequent attempts to sell it.
Lawyers representing Jackson said he would try again to sell the property to raise funds after filing for bankruptcy over the summer.
However, Rob Giuffria, a realtor in Farmington and an expert in the area’s high-end real estate, said the property still won’t sell.
He told the Hartford Courant:
‘$8.5million? Not a chance. 50 would have a better chance being a country music singer.’
He does not believe the property, set on 17 acres, will sell for more than $5million. The mansion, which has been listed Douglas Elliman Real Estate, is one of the biggest private residences in America. Jackson bought the house in 2003 from boxer Mike Tyson for $4.1million.
He then spent more than $6million renovating the house and its grounds, and installed a helicopter pad, infinity pool and private cinema.
The home also has a private casino, gym, racquetball courts and disco room with stripper poles. There are 52 rooms in total, including nine kitchens.
But after failing to sell it in 2007, the price was reduced four times – to $10million by the end of 2010.It reportedly costs $72,000 a month to maintain.
Nigeria Football Federation (NFF) has hinted that Super Eagles team will be restricted on their use of social media while on international duty following the brawl between Sunday Oliseh and Vincent Enyeama last Tuesday.
President of the NFF, Amaju Pinnick made this known after a meeting in Belgium on Saturday. He said a code of conduct document would be released soon and it involves restrictions on social media.
Pinnick is quoted saying:
“A small group had been working on the document and I am happy to say that it is now ready for implementation. This will spell out how players and officials must conduct themselves while in any of the national camps, and minimize the probability of misunderstanding between coaches and players.
“The recent happening in the camp of the Super Eagles in Belgium was unwarranted but I am happy we have been able to put that behind us. Both Coach Sunday Oliseh and player Vincent Enyeama even spoke cordially on Saturday during Enyeama’s meeting with the NFF leadership,
“No player launches his career through the social media. When players are at their clubs, they don’t broadcast camp situation on Twitter, Facebook or Instagram, The same restraint and discipline must be observed in the national camp.”
